Description
  • Intense fruit and racy freshness
  • Ripe lemon, peach, pineapple, almonds, brioche and liquorice

 

The Delamotte Blanc de Blancs 2018 has an incredibly intense, seductive fruitiness: lemon floats above vineyard peach and pineapple. Almonds, vanilla brioche and liquorice, caramel and white blossom complete the fascinating spectrum of aromas. Delamotte is otherwise sophisticated but light, so the richness of this Chardonnay champagne is unexpected. However, the elegance, ultra-fine perlage and minerality veiled by the silky palate are typical.

The 2018 is even better than the 2008 and a champagne that we highly recommend.

Champagne Delamotte was founded in 1760 by François Delamotte, who already owned vineyards in Champagne. The house is one of the five oldest champagne houses. Delamotte remained in the family for many generations and even changed its name. At the end of the 1940s, it was bought by the de Nonancourt family, owners of Laurent-Perrier, who renamed it Delamotte. After the purchase of the renowned Salon house in 1989, Delamotte and Salon were merged. They are neighbours in Mesnil-sur-Oger anyway.

While Salon comes from the same twenty parcels in Le Mesnil-sur-Oger, Delamotte now owns six hectares in the heart of the Côte des Blancs, including in Avize, Cramant, Le Mesnil-sur-Oger and Oger. The grapes for Delamotte champagnes come exclusively from the Grand Cru and Premier Cru villages of the Côte des Blancs, and the chalky character of the soils is clearly evident in the champagne. The champagnes are always fermented in stainless steel tanks and mature on the lees for at least six years before being riddled and disgorged. This gives them a creamy palate and a fine perlage, as well as their distinctive lemon-dominated aroma spectrum.
